I Saved Obasanjo From A Deadly Injection’ – Atiku Reveals

Presidential candidate of the African Democratic Congress (ADC), Atiku Abubakar, has claimed that he helped save former President Olusegun Obasanjo from a potentially fatal injection while the former military leader was in prison.

According to Ireporter Online, Atiku made the claim while speaking with journalists about his long-standing political relationship with Obasanjo and the events that shaped their time in government.

The former Vice-President alleged that he received information about a plan to administer an injection to Obasanjo during his incarceration and subsequently warned him against accepting it.

Atiku linked the alleged plot to the death of former Chief of Staff Supreme Military Council, General Shehu Musa Yar’Adua, who died in detention in 1997.

He said, “I saved Obasanjo’s life in prison by leaking information about an impending injection that could have killed him.”

Atiku further claimed that a similar incident had occurred in Yar’Adua’s case and that the information he received prompted him to caution Obasanjo against accepting the injection.

The ADC candidate also attributed the deterioration in his relationship with Obasanjo to his opposition to the former president’s controversial bid for a third term in office.

Atiku said his stance against the move created lasting political differences between both men.

He added, “Today, he wants the world to hate me because I opposed his third-term ambition.”

Atiku and Obasanjo served together as President and Vice-President of Nigeria respectively from 1999 to 2007, during which their relationship was marked by both political cooperation and significant disagreements.
